Happy People Do These 10 Things Differently

Most of us aspire to live a fulfilled and happy life, seeking satisfaction, joy, and energy. It’s important to begin each day managing our energy resources.  Think of energy as money in a bank account, we can either deposit or withdraw from our account, and it fluctuates depending on our activities.   The aim is to have more in our accounts and not be in overdraft!   Often a few tweaks to your regular habits can create more happiness in our lives – our habits matter. 

Let’s start by looking at some of the habits or daily routines that can increase your energy account. Add as many as you feel comfortable with or that work with your lifestyle.

  1. Start your day with a morning routine – morning routine helps to keep your day flowing in a non-stressful way.  It can be helpful to have your gym clothes out, or your work outfit chosen, and a big glass of prepared lemon water prepared to start your day.  Schedule time to do things like exercise, meditate, pray, or eat a nutritious prepared breakfast.  The most important factor is that your routine is sustainable and consistent.
  2. Smile – Try smiling at yourself in the mirror each morning.  Smiling causes the brain to release dopamine, which in turn makes us happier.  Throughout the day you can find times to smile to bring up your mood. 
  3. Eat nourishing food – A well-balanced, healthy diet high in fruits and vegetables and lean protein, is at the core of well-being and energy. You really are what you eat.  Consume a variety of foods from all the food groups to get a range of nutrients and to provide energy throughout the day.  Choose fresh when possible, including all the colours of the rainbow.
  4. Get regular exercise – Exercise can help reduce stress, strengthen muscles, boost endurance, and helps your body work more efficiently.  Any amount of physical activity can make a difference, try taking a walk every night after dinner, sign up for a yoga class or include a few minutes of stretching daily.
  5. Practice Gratitude – Simply being grateful can give your mood a boost, have an attitude of gratitude. Start taking note of things you are grateful for, as you become more aware of the many good things in your everyday life.  It’s easy to take a few minutes each day to write down the things you are grateful for. 
  6. Keep company with good people – Be selective about the company you keep, connecting with others who radiate positivity and have similar interests will energize you.  It’s important to set limits and boundaries with the people who do not refill your energy reserves.
  7. Set aside time for self-care – It’s easy to get caught up with business.  Take time to nurture yourself so that you can be at your best emotionally, physically, and mentally.  Make time for you a priority and talk to yourself, say things like: “You’ll make it through this.”, or “You’ve got this.” Getting in the habit of saying “I love you” to yourself can increase feelings of self-worth boosting inner strength.
  8. Give Back – Any act of kindness, big or small, can contribute to happy good feelings. Seek out a cause that means something to you and find a way to give back!
  9. Give a compliment – Giving a compliment is a quick, easy way to brighten someone’s day.  It’s surprising how good this can feel.  It’s even better if you can say it with a smile, giving your own happiness a boost. 
  10. Prioritizing sleep – is one of the best things you can do to set yourself up for a successful, energized day. Sleep deprivation can affect us negatively by affecting mood, motivation, and energy levels. Getting quality sleep at least 7-8 hours nightly is a healthy habit.   To improve your sleep, create a relaxing and restful environment, minimizing both light and noise, and turning off electronic devices.
